If a tube is filled with fluid (hydrosalpinx), simply unblocking it often isn't enough because the fluid is toxic to embryos. In these cases, doctors often recommend (removal of the tube) before proceeding with IVF, rather than attempting to repair the tube. how to unblock blocked fallopian tubes

Fallopian tube blockage is a common cause of infertility, often preventing the sperm and egg from meeting or a fertilized egg from reaching the uterus. While natural remedies and lifestyle changes may support overall reproductive health, medical and surgical interventions are the primary methods for physically reopening tubes. Blocked fallopian tubes (tubal factor infertility) prevent the egg from meeting sperm and block the embryo from reaching the uterus. In many cases, they can be treated, but the method depends on where the blockage is (proximal, near the uterus, or distal, near the ovary) and what caused it (scar tissue, infection, adhesions).

IVF bypasses the tubes entirely. Eggs are retrieved from the ovaries, fertilized with sperm in a lab, and the resulting embryo is placed directly into the uterus. This is often the most successful route for women with severe tubal factor infertility.
